Abstract

With the inclusion of a single gluon magnetic exchange term, the M.I.T. static spherical cavity spectrum of\(q^2 \bar q^2 \) bag eigenstates contains a pair of nearly degenerateJ P=0+ states in both theI=0 and 1 channels; possibly associated with theS *(980) and δ(980). The effect of pair annihilation-induced mixing on these states is investigated and is shown to result in radical changes. For small mixing the bag energy curves have two minima. As the mixing strength is increased, one of these minima disappears and is replaced by a new higher lying state.
